State-of-the-Art Production & Quality Control

Our geotextiles, geomembranes, and geocells are manufactured under strict operational parameter guidelines to guarantee that final products withstand severe stresses in structural applications.

1

Raw Material Preparation

The main raw materials of geotextile are polyester chips, polypropylene filament and viscose fiber. These raw materials need to be inspected, arranged and stored to ensure their quality and stability.

2

Melt Extrusion

After the polyester slice is melted at high temperatures, it is extruded into a molten state by a screw extruder, and polypropylene filament and viscose fiber are added for mixing. In this process, the temperature, pressure and other parameters need to be precisely controlled to ensure the uniformity and stability of the melting state.

3

Roll the Net

After mixing, the melt is sprayed through the spinneret to form a fibrous substance and form a uniform network structure on the conveyor belt. At this time, it is necessary to control the thickness, uniformity and fiber orientation of the mesh to ensure the physical properties and stability of the geotextile.

Rolling Net Facility
4

Draft Curing

After laying the net into rolls, it is necessary to carry out draft curing treatment. In this process, the temperature, speed and draft ratio need to be precisely controlled to ensure the strength and stability of the geotextile.

5

Roll and Pack

The geotextile after draft curing needs to be rolled up and packed for subsequent construction. In this process, the length, width and thickness of the geotextile need to be measured to ensure that it meets the design requirements.

Rolling and Packaging
6

Quality Inspection

At the end of each production link, the quality of geotextile needs to be inspected. The inspection contents include physical property test, chemical property test and appearance quality test. Only geotextiles that meet the quality requirements can be used in the market.

Engineering Guidelines & Tech Support

Selecting, Laying & Maintaining Geomembranes

A sound deployment is critical to securing the designed service life of geosynthetic systems in hydraulic or roadway structures. We provide complete technical consulting regarding selection, installation parameters, and maintenance practices.

1. Select Geomembrane

It is very important to choose the suitable geomembrane. Here are some key points to choose geomembrane:

  • Material properties: Geomembranes are divided into different materials, such as high density polyethylene (HDPE) and linear low density polyethylene (LLDPE). Select the appropriate material according to the engineering requirements.
  • Thickness: Select the appropriate thickness according to the needs of the project. The thickness of the geomembrane is usually 0.3mm to 2.0mm.
  • Impermeability: Ensure that the geomembrane has good impermeability to prevent water in the soil from penetrating into the project.

2. Geomembrane Laying

The laying of geomembrane needs to follow certain steps and techniques:

  • Land preparation: Ensure that the land where the geomembrane is laid is level and clean, and sharp objects and other obstacles are removed.
  • Laying method: Geomembrane can be covered laying or folding laying. Select the appropriate laying method according to the project requirements.
  • Joint treatment: Joint treatment is performed at the joint of the geomembrane to ensure that there is no leakage at the joint.
  • Fixing method: Use fixed parts to fix the geomembrane and ensure that it is closely attached to the ground.
Geomembrane Laying Site

3. Maintenance of Geomembrane

Maintenance of geomembrane can extend its service life and function:

  • Cleaning: Regularly clean the surface of the geomembrane to remove dirt and debris to maintain its impermeability.
  • Inspection: Regularly check whether the geomembrane is damaged or aging, repair or replace the damaged part in time.
  • Avoid sharp objects: Avoid sharp objects from touching the geomembrane to prevent damage.

In Summary: The application technology of geomembrane includes selecting suitable geomembrane, laying geomembrane correctly and maintaining geomembrane regularly. Reasonable application of geomembrane can effectively improve the functions of seepage prevention, isolation and reinforcement of engineering projects, and provide guarantee for the smooth progress of engineering.

Geomembrane Application in Hydraulic Engineering

Geomembrane, as an efficient anti-seepage material, plays a vital role in water conservancy projects. Its excellent anti-seepage performance, light and easy construction characteristics and relatively low cost make geomembrane become an indispensable part of water conservancy projects.

Reservoir Anti-seepage

Reservoir Containment

In the construction of reservoirs, geomembrane plays a critical anti-seepage role. Because reservoirs are usually built in valleys or low-lying areas with complex geological conditions, the use of geomembrane effectively prevents leakage between the bottom of the reservoir and surrounding rock structures, increasing overall system safety.

Levee Reinforcement

Levee and Dike Support

During the construction of levees, geomembrane reinforces the anti-seepage barriers. Since dikes protect downstream locations from unpredictable flooding forces, installing geomembranes provides structural support and seals potential voids in the earthen dam design.

River Channel Governance

River and Channel Governance

Rivers and channels are vital components of modern municipal water governance. Using geomembranes resolves common geotechnical failure hazards like seepage loop erosion, bank sliding, and lateral soil shift, optimizing the regional ecosystem.

Q1: How do geocells improve structural load support in road constructions across Luxembourg?

Geocells employ a 3D honeycombed cell confinement configuration. When filled with granular materials, the cells confine the aggregate laterally. Under wheel loads, this confinement generates high passive resistance, distributing stress over a broader base area. This mechanism prevents rutting, soil shifting, and reduces sub-base thickness demands by 30% to 50% on soft foundation profiles common in local valleys.

Q2: What parameters distinguish HDPE from LLDPE geomembranes for containment applications?

HDPE (High-Density Polyethylene) provides exceptional chemical resistance, high stiffness, and long-term aging durability, making it ideal for landfill liners and municipal water reservoirs. LLDPE (Linear Low-Density Polyethylene) offers superior flexibility, elongation characteristics, and puncture resistance, making it suitable for uneven soil surfaces or localized designs requiring steep slope contours.
